What is Oberon Work Orchestration Platform?
Oberon Work Orchestration Platform is an AI-powered tool built to help large organizations manage their workforce efficiently. It focuses on planning, building, and managing project teams through smart automation and data insights. The system matches employees' skills with project roles, detects skill gaps, and suggests training or mentorship opportunities. It can generate team roles from project details, adjust team compositions in real-time, and monitor skill development over time.
Oberon easily integrates with popular management platforms like Jira, Asana, and learning systems. This allows users to update team data live and make quick decisions to improve project delivery and resource use. The platform offers a dashboard that shows team status, potential risks, and upcoming needs. It enables managers to see an overview of workforce performance instantly.
The tool supports several key tasks such as building teams, finding skilled resources, managing team changes, tracking skills, and forecasting future workforce requirements. It helps automate staffing based on current skills and availability, making the process faster and more accurate. It also identifies skill gaps and recommends training or mentorship to enhance team capabilities. Additionally, Oberon facilitates dynamic team adjustments, optimizing costs and skills in real-time.
